Coffee is traded via a market that is referred to as the coffee exchange. These coffee exchanges/ markets vary depending on the type of coffee that is traded through it. A combination of rising global consumption and weather events have pushed coffee prices up.The Coffee C Futures contract, traded on the Intercontinental Exchange (ICE), is the global benchmark for Arabica coffee prices. It represents the expected price of coffee for future delivery, allowing buyers and sellers to hedge against market fluctuations.
